메인 콘텐츠로 건너뛰기
특정 모델에서 사용 가능한 모든 프로바이더 엔드포인트를 조회합니다. 이 엔드포인트를 사용하여 프로바이더별 가격, 컨텍스트 길이, 양자화, 기능 지원을 확인할 수 있습니다.

엔드포인트

GET /api/v1/models/{author}/{slug}/endpoints

경로 파라미터

파라미터설명
author모델 작성자 (예: openai, anthropic, google)
slug모델 슬러그 (예: gpt-5.4, claude-sonnet-4.6)

요청 예시

curl "https://api.arouter.ai/api/v1/models/openai/gpt-5.4/endpoints" \
  -H "Authorization: Bearer lr_live_xxxx"

응답 예시

{
  "data": [
    {
      "provider_id": "OpenAI",
      "provider_name": "OpenAI",
      "model": "openai/gpt-5.4",
      "context_length": 128000,
      "max_completion_tokens": 16384,
      "pricing": {
        "prompt": 0.0000025,
        "completion": 0.0000100,
        "image": 0.0,
        "request": 0.0
      },
      "quantization": "fp16",
      "is_zdr": true,
      "supported_parameters": ["tools", "response_format", "stream", "max_tokens"]
    },
    {
      "provider_id": "Azure",
      "provider_name": "Azure OpenAI",
      "model": "openai/gpt-5.4",
      "context_length": 128000,
      "max_completion_tokens": 16384,
      "pricing": {
        "prompt": 0.0000025,
        "completion": 0.0000100
      },
      "quantization": "fp16",
      "is_zdr": true,
      "supported_parameters": ["tools", "response_format", "stream", "max_tokens"]
    }
  ]
}

응답 필드

필드타입설명
provider_idstring라우팅에 사용할 프로바이더 ID
provider_namestring사람이 읽을 수 있는 프로바이더 이름
modelstring전체 모델 ID
context_lengthinteger최대 입력 컨텍스트 (토큰 수)
max_completion_tokensinteger최대 출력 토큰 수
pricing.promptnumber프롬프트 토큰당 비용 (USD)
pricing.completionnumber완성 토큰당 비용 (USD)
quantizationstring가중치 양자화: fp32, fp16, bf16, fp8, int8, int4
is_zdrboolean이 엔드포인트가 제로 데이터 보유를 지원하는지 여부
supported_parametersstring[]이 엔드포인트가 지원하는 파라미터

참고 사항

  • 이 엔드포인트의 프로바이더 ID를 provider.order, provider.only, provider.ignore에 사용하세요
  • 가격은 토큰당 (1k 토큰당이 아님)
  • 엔드포인트 기능별 라우팅은 프로바이더 라우팅을 참조하세요